Essential EnglishPhrases for Exercising

Whether you’re at the gym, taking a fitness class, or just working out at home, knowing some basic English phrases can significantly improve your communication and understanding. This article provides a handy guide to essential phrases you’ll encounter during your exercise routine.
Before You Start: Getting Ready
- “What kind of workout are you planning today?” – Asking about the training plan.
- “Are you ready to go?” – Simple phrase to begin.
- “I need to warm up first.” – Indicating you need to prepare yourbody.
- “Let’s start with some stretching.” – Initiating the warm-up routine.
- “Can you show me how to…?” – Asking for instructions or guidance.
- “What’s the proper form for this exercise?” – Askingfor advice on technique.
- “Do you have any water?” – Requesting hydration.
During Your Workout: Active Participation
- “I’m feeling strong today!” – Expressing your energy levels.
- “I’m feeling a bit tired.” – Indicating fatigue.
- “One more rep!” – Encouraging yourself or a partner.
- “I’m going to take a break.” – Announcing a rest period.
- “Ican’t do any more.” – Indicating physical limit.
- “How much weight should I use?” – Asking about appropriate resistance.
- “Spot me, please?” – Requesting assistance.
- “Can you time me?” – Requestingsomeone to time your sets.
- “I need a heavier / lighter weight.” – Requesting a change in resistance.
- “Is my form okay?” – Asking for form correction.
After Your Workout: Cooling Down & Recovery
- “That was a great workout!” – Expressing satisfaction.
- “I feel good.” – Expressing how you feel.
- “I’m sore, but it feels good.” – Describing post-workout soreness.
- “I need to cool down.” – Indicating a cool-down routine.
- “Let’s stretch.” – Suggesting a cool-down strategy.
- “Time for a protein shake!” – Suggesting a post-workout recovery plan.
- “See you next time!” – Saying goodbye and looking forward.
General Gym/Fitness Related Phrases
- “What time does the gym close?” – Asking for the opening and closing hours.
- “Where are the freeweights?” – Locating equipment.
- “Is this machine available?” – Asking about the availability of equipment.
- “Can I use this?” – Asking to use an equipment.
- “Please wipe down the machine.” – Requesting after use cleaning.
- “Rest for a minute (or two).” – Suggesting a rest period.
